Super Bowl LX Tickets: Limited Face-Value, High Prices Await

Story summary
- The Seattle Seahawks and the New England Patriots each receive about 12,450 tickets for Super Bowl LX.
- Teams must set aside at least 35% of their tickets for fans, leaving about 11,520 face-value tickets.
- The NFL retains about 25.2% of total tickets, with many going to its official hospitality provider.
- Secondary-market tickets start around $6,400, with the average price near $8,004.
- Face-value tickets remain a rare opportunity.
